Originally Posted by dinodino
how do you control it?
Simply put.. you don't. Your rear passengers do.

Originally Posted by dinodino
Is there a remote?
Yes, but it only works if you are pointing it towards the back of the headrest, and even if you manage to do it from the driver seat, you have no visual of what the remote is doing.

Another thing is if you want to use the aux jacks in via the RSE (these are found below the passenger seats) The Headrest LCD screen has to be on.
